PACIFIC HEIGHTS —This week the Drew School celebrated its new LEED-Gold Samuel M. Cuddeback III Assembly Wing, which features a 3.5-story vertical garden and living roof that was designed by famous Parisian botanist Patrick Blanc. It also has new classrooms and a state-of-the-art performance arts and assembly space. Students performed music from Little Shop of Horrors to highlight the vertical garden. [Curbed Inbox]
